Skip to content

Commit b134c81

Browse files
authored
Python Previewer: Initialize Shumate (#884)
See: - workbenchdev/demos#94 - #879 - #738
1 parent 99d35b7 commit b134c81

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

src/langs/python/python-previewer.py

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-22,6 +22,7 @@
2222
gi.require_version("Graphene", "1.0")
2323
gi.require_version("Gsk", "4.0")
2424
gi.require_version("GtkSource", "5")
25+
gi.require_version("Shumate", "1.0")
2526
gi.require_version("WebKit", "6.0")
2627
gi.require_version("Workbench", "0")
2728

@@ -34,6 +35,7 @@
3435
Graphene,
3536
Gio,
3637
GtkSource,
38+
Shumate,
3739
WebKit,
3840
Workbench,
3941
)
@@ -44,6 +46,7 @@
4446
Adw.init()
4547
GtkSource.init()
4648
GObject.type_ensure(WebKit.WebView)
49+
GObject.type_ensure(Shumate.SimpleMap)
4750

4851
resource = Gio.Resource.load(
4952
f'/app/share/{os.environ["FLATPAK_ID"]}/re.sonny.Workbench.libworkbench.gresource'

0 commit comments

Comments
 (0)